'The Sky's the Limit!' Tampa Buccaneers Offensive Tackle Praises New Coach - Athlon Sports

With the Tampa Bay Buccaneers entering their fourth consecutive season with a new offensive coordinator, optimism is high as they aim to elevate their performance in 2025. Newly promoted offensive coordinator Josh Grizzard inherits a unit that has seen success with past leaders moving on to head coaching roles. Tackle Luke Goedeke expressed confidence in their offensive line's potential, stating, 'the sky is the limit' for their performance this season.

Goedeke believes that the Bucs' offensive capabilities could rank among the best in the NFL, highlighting their collective determination to strive for excellence. The offseason workouts have been relatively light, yet the players are eager to build on their strengths and achieve their ambitious goals. The Bucs are positioning themselves to be a formidable offense in the upcoming season.

Top 2026 NFL free agents: Best players available next year

As NFL teams gear up for next season, the landscape of free agency in 2026 is taking shape, with several star players set to hit the market. T.J. Watt of the Pittsburgh Steelers leads the list after consistently dominating as a linebacker, while Tee Higgins of the Cincinnati Bengals is poised to attract significant attention following two years of being franchise tagged. Other notable names include Danielle Hunter from the Houston Texans, and promising tight end Trey McBride from the Arizona Cardinals, who made his Pro Bowl debut last year.

Alongside these stars, offensive lineman Trey Smith from the Kansas City Chiefs and Kaleb McGary of the Atlanta Falcons have established themselves as key players in their respective positions. The 2026 free agency class is shaping up to be a vibrant mix of seasoned veterans and emerging talents, making it a critical moment for franchises looking to bolster their rosters.

Buccaneers Could Make Big Offseason Move With Right Tackle in 2025

The Tampa Bay Buccaneers' 2024 season ended with a narrow defeat to the Washington Commanders in the Wild Card playoffs, marking a year filled with challenges for the team. Despite the loss, the season was not entirely without merit, as the Bucs demonstrated substantial resilience and laid the groundwork for future progress.

Looking ahead to the 2025 offseason, the Buccaneers are expected to address various issues that impacted their previous campaign, particularly on the defensive side. However, the offensive lineup is likely to remain familiar, with potential additions to enhance performance. One key move anticipated is the extension of right tackle Luke Goedeke, who has shown significant improvement, particularly with an impressive 89.5% pass block win rate this past season.

Experts suggest that locking in Goedeke on a long-term deal before the final year of his rookie contract will be crucial for maintaining stability on the offensive line, an area recognized as vital for NFL success. The Buccaneers aim to build on this continuity as they look to improve their performance in the upcoming seasons.

Buccaneers O-Line Was Big Reason For Win vs. Chargers in Week 15

The Tampa Bay Buccaneers showcased an impressive offensive performance against the Los Angeles Chargers, amassing 283 passing yards and 223 rushing yards. Key contributions came from quarterback Baker Mayfield, wide receiver Mike Evans, and running back Bucky Irving, but the offensive line's stellar play was crucial.

Pro Football Focus highlighted the offensive line's effectiveness, noting they allowed only five pressures and no sacks during the game. Tristan Wirfs stood out with an 89.0 pass-blocking grade, while Luke Goedeke also received recognition for his performance. The Buccaneers' offensive line will face a tougher challenge next week against the Dallas Cowboys.
